Take screen breaks

WebTake regular breaks from your screens at work. The most effective breaks help us to switch off and give our brain and body a chance to reset. Ideally, we would use this time to step away from our screens, including phones. Even the presence of a phone nearby has been found to increase the stress hormone cortisol. Return to work following depression, anxiety or a related …

WebEstimates of the 1-month prevalence of mental disorders in employees range from 10.5% to 18.5%. Most are high prevalence disorders such as anxiety and depression. Lim et al. 2000. Kessler et al, 1997. Mental disorders in the workplace. Work Outcomes Research Cost-benefit (WORC) Project involving 60 000 Australian employees.
